The '''Hostile Program''' is a computer virus deployed by the [[Master Control Program]] that appears in ''[[Kingdom Hearts II]]''. It serves as a boss during [[Sora]]'s first visit to [[Space Paranoids]].

The Hostile Program is an emergency destruct program for Radiant Garden. The MCP finds this program within the [[DTD]] once [[Tron]] enters the password, and deploys it to the I/O Tower in order to destroy the town. Sora, [[Donald]], [[Goofy]], and Tron intercept the program and destroy it before it can be uploaded.
==Design==

The Hostile Program is large and robotic in appearance. It has a smooth, oval-shaped upper body that is indigo in coloration and lined with light grey and red computer circuitry. Nine red, conical spikes protrude from the upper body, and an opening on the front side of it reveals the Hostile Program's three glowing, yellow eyes, which are arranged in a triangular pattern. A smaller opening appears just below this one.
